Subject: Ledger service 4.2 going to production Thursday

Hello plugin authors,

The Emberline loyalty-points ledger moves to version 4.2 this Thursday. Point accrual hooks now fire after settlement, not before, so update any plugins that assume the old ordering. Sandbox access is already on 4.2. The release candidate is identified by the token below.

pipeline stamp: htk9_6ce9d33c5

Hey — welcome aboard! Quick handover on the Lanternfall serverless stuff before I'm out. Cold starts on the ingest handlers are brutal after deploys; we keep a warmer pinging them every four minutes, config lives in the Pipwick repo. If latency spikes past 2s, check whether the warmer cron got disabled again (it happens). Don't bump memory past 512MB without asking Dorrit, she tracks the budget. If the warmer's own vault locks you out, you'll need the recovery passphrase, which is:

strongbox words: prawyn-fenmir

Subject: Q2 Cash-Flow Forecast — Briefing for Incoming Director

Welcome aboard. Attached context ahead of Monday: the Q2 forecast shows positive operating cash flow, driven by earlier-than-expected Greywick renewals and slower capex on the Stonebarrow build-out. Receivables aging has improved since the collections push in March. Two sensitivities to note: the Ardenfell contract timing and seasonal payroll in the Luthene office. Happy to walk through line items live. The strategic framing follows below.

internal memo for fahif-bawip: Headcount on the Ralael team goes from 48 to 96 by the end of December. Gross margin on Ralael came in at 14 percent against a plan of 3 percent.

### Changed

- Renamed `PAY_RETRY_KEY_MODE` to `IDEMPOTENCY_KEY_MODE` in the Quillbank gateway config. Behavior is unchanged: retried payment requests reuse the original idempotency key, preventing duplicate charges during network flaps. The old name is rejected at boot to avoid silent misconfiguration. Key derivation still requires the HMAC secret, set on the next line.

env line for fafof-fahag: LEDGER_TOKEN5=f8790